DEKALB, Ill. – Voting is now open for the 2019 Play of the Year, which will be presented at the 10th annual "Victors" awards show at the Carl Sandberg Auditorium on Thursday, May 2 at 7 p.m.
This year's nominees are Mikayla Voigt's game-winning layup to beat Western Michigan in the MAC Tournament First Round, Max Scharping's two-point conversion to help the Huskies to a Homecoming victory over Ohio, Mia Lord's balance beam routine to help NIU clinch the MAC Championship and Noah McCarty's game-winning layup to lift the Huskies past 14th-ranked Buffalo.
Voting on the four semifinalists will be conducted on NIUHuskies.com and is open until 5 p.m., on Monday, April 29. The top two plays will then be voted on via Twitter on @NIUAthletics on the day of the Victors.
Free to the public, the all-sports ESPY-esque awards show celebrates the academic, athletic and community service accomplishments of this year's student-athletes. The red carpet will be rolled out and the doors open at 6 p.m. to begin the social hour with the student-athletes, coaches and athletics staff.
More than 20 different awards including male and female athlete of the year, newcomer of the year, along with Mr. and Miss Victor E. Huskie, an award given to student-athletes who represent commitment to developing as a champion in the classroom, in competition and in life. Results from the 2018 spring, 2018 fall and 2018-19 winter sports were considered in the nominations.
